The Industrial and Commercial Bank of China (ICBC) has been helping Myanmar in development of the country's banking and monetary services by nurturing skilled banking personnel, Xinhua reported on 22 October.
Speaking at the opening of the "Belt and Road, Golden Myanmar" Financial Services Summit, He Biqing, the general manager of ICBC's Yangon branch was quoted as saying that as one of the world's largest banks, ICBC would like to assist Myanmar develop its work skills and professionalism for the development of the country's banking and monetary sector as 80 percent of the bank staff are from Myanmar.
The summit took place at a time when Myanmar is experiencing economic reform and ICBC would like to discuss and exchange its experiences with its Myanmar counterparts, he added.
